Kagurabachi's Popularity: Familiarity Through Structure
Having a degree in writing and media is so fun because I can write an essay on why Kagurabachi can be defined as well written through craft standards and attribute its popularity overseas to its structure, which is framed similarly to western movies.
And I am!
After this interview confirmed that Takeru Hokazono, author of Kagurabachi, is a huge fan of western films, I went back to this idea I was playing with in October when KB had less than ten chapters. I had been reading since day one, and I knew it was good, and other overseas fan knew it was good. But what made it so good to us, overseas?
I made a quick thread on it on my Twitter account (that I never posted) where I mentioned Blake Snyder's Save the Cat book on script writing and story structure. I also brought up characterization and how it would've been really popular in my comic book class from undergrad. This thread discussed both Chihiro and Sojo, and the quick yet steady pace of the manga has given us more characters and moments to pinpoint. To not overwhelm myself, I'm not going to discuss the craft of characterization (maybe another time), and I'm not going to do a beat sheet for Sojo. For now, I'll try to stay under the first arc to map out why Kagurabachi has so far moved like a high budget film in manga form. So, spoilers ahead!
A quick lesson on Save the Cat, its three main characteristics are: Three act structure Fifteen plot beats Mostly applied to American Hollywood films
One of the biggest things I noticed right away was the resemblance a lot of the chapters, even the story as a whole, had to Snyder's beat sheet. This beat sheet that comes from Snyder's book is somewhat of an industry standard, so a lot of movies, even those that preceded Snyder, go through this structure of Act 1, 2, and 3. Snyder just identified the parts and broke them down to fifteen beats. Plus he dubbed the save the cat moment:
A decisive moment in which a protagonist demonstrates they are worth rooting for. Having the protagonist save a cat can be literal or figurative.
This was something KB needed and did have to have us warm up to Chihiro who post time skip, just gave gloomy orphan energy in the previous chapters. Here, Char would be our cat. Chihiro chose to save Char and chose to protect her, and continued to fight for her until she was rescued. He made this choice even before it's revealed that Char's mother died for her, something that would parallel Chihiro. This is what got readers to see him three dimensionally after being introduced to him. He's still the caring little 14 year old we saw at the start, who continues to take care of the innocent despite the tragedy he's been through. It is only natural for us to care for him, too.
Tumblr media
Above are the fifteen beats of Save the Cat and although KB on occasion doesn't hit all fifteen exactly as specified, especially final image as it's continuing, the song and dance is quite similar. Here are examples of The Dark Knight (2008) and Inglourious Basterds (2009), two movies that have inspired Hokazono's work.
Before Chihiro meets Char, we get his opening image of him and his dad forging which is works well as the entire story revolves on the consequences of them creating weapons. We get the set up to his world where he lives with his dad who made famous katanas that wield the power to end a war. The theme is stated, and it's not kept a secret: The katanas they make are weapons made to kill people. Are they willing to carry the burden? In another variation of this question, is Chihiro willing to carry the burdens unintentionally passed down by his father?
The catalyst is his father's murder that catapults him into seeking revenge and recover the katanas.
Now, for the rest of the story, this structure can be applied to the first 18 chapters or even 1-3 chapters at a time which in my opinion, is kind of insane. There's story telling inside the story telling, and these moments are both subtle and grand, signs of a strong and captivating writer. Hollywood would kill for a script like this these days. In order to get you to believe me how prominent these beats are, I'm going to do arc one and Daruma's story. The main story line should be around act one and two right now as of chapter 20, if we want to get down into it, but if anything, this feels like it's moving like a second "movie."
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
Overall, this structure that comes from Hollywood movies can be identified in multiples parts of Kagurbachi's storytelling. I was going to do beat sheet's for Char and Sojo's stories as well, but I think this is enough of an example of a bigger picture versus smaller. Although other mangas also fall into three act structures, as most story telling does, KB masterfully uses the 15 beats to its advantage. I believe the familiarity of this pace is what hooked oversea audiences, and aside from that, the characters that quickly capture us.
Very quickly, because I don't want to make this about characterization, Chihiro is well written through his past, who he chooses to kill and save, his dialogue that can be surprisingly vulnerable at times, and his cool façade that melts because of how hot he truly runs. He is also straight up a badass. We get handed Char's background in an "all is lost" segment as well as some lore that can present her as a resource for the main cast. We see Azami's phone background photo that's minimum 3+ years old- a government employee with a soft spot for his friends, one who he is still clearly grieving. We get one tiny yet so fucked up bit of Sojo when we see him get a flashback where he's a child and his single dialogue of "I truly love Kunishige Rokuhira," that launched his type of villainy in the maniacal fanboy category. Who does it like that? Nobody but Takeru Hokazono.

Quick summary of the plot: the MC is a young guy named Chihiro Rokuhira who's out for revenge after his father Kunishige, one of Japan's most famous swordsmiths, was killed 3 years before, and those same people, a group of evil sorcerers known as the ?, stole all 6 of his father's enchanted swords, but chihiro has a 7th special sword that his father kept secret from everyone but him.
Edit: this might be important for some people so I'll add that Chihiro is 18, since we saw him with his dad as a 14 going on 15 year old and the story fast forwards to more than 3 years later in the first chapter, which would make him 18
He's joined by his father's best friend, a sorcerer named Shiba who becomes his mentor and informant about the shady business going on in Tokyo, Azami who's another sorcerer and friend of his father's and Shiba, a little girl named Char who comes from a family that has the ability to regenerate their body parts and is being hunted for it, a young woman named Hinao who's a weapons dealer, and later on another young man named Hakuri who comes from a different sorcerer family but defected bc he's the only one who doesn't know sorcery (and was abused).
Personality wise, Chihiro is the more level-headed, serious, and reserved type but shows great care and sympathy for those who need help, for ex. when he helps out char from being hunted and experimented on, and when he traded his beloved sword for Hakuri. His father had a huge impact on his philosophy about life and weapons.
He does want revenge for his father's death, but his greatest motivation however is to prevent anyone from tarnishing his father's legacy which are his enchanted swords, bc kunishige made sure to let Chihiro know that his swords are weapons first and foremost, and when put in the wrong hands are destructive and lethal.
The power system is fairly simple, based in sorcery, which for Chihiro is channeled through his enchanted sword called Enten from which 3 different goldfish, each having their own ability, appear (and the goldfish are the same ones his father had before he died: a black goldfish, a red one, and a spotted one).
The enchanted swords that Kunishige made come from a rock (?) called datenseki, which we don't know much about yet.
And about the first antagonist we meet, Sojo. He's a weapons dealer in the black market and does other criminal activities. He also has one of the 6 enchanted swords that was stolen, this one called Cloud Gouger. To me, this fight is reminiscent to Yuji vs Mahito in the Shibuya arc of Jujutsu Kaisen, in the sense that Chihiro has to accept that despite what he personally believes about his father and his swords, Sojo also can have his own contradictory beliefs bc it's the person who wields the sword that gets to determine it's fate. Chapter 12: Tea I believe is pivotal in Chihiro's development and is one of the best chapters so far. I like the metaphor with Sojo offering Chihiro dango, which he refuses at the beginning (he says he doesn't like sweets) and by the end eats it, even if doesn't like it, because it reflects his acceptance with Sojo's philosophy about the blades.
